Company History
 

The business operations of Monroe's Donuts and Bakery began in the family den of the Monroe's home in 1995, next door to the current business site.

At that time, Monroe Jackson was working two jobs as well operating a small bakery.  The family den may have seemed an unlikely place to purchase a donut, but they were so good, until soon, a regular clientelle emerged, who kept encouraging Monroe to pursue his dreams. 

In 2003, the Monroes' home was destroyed by hurricane wind; however, the insurance funds, along with a small business loan, was used to build the current two story structure.  The lower floor was converted into the bakery, and the upper level became the Monroe's resident.  

Monroe Jackson learned the art of baking while employed at Hoeffken's Bakery in Chicago, Illinois.  Raymond Hoeffken, the business owner, who was a German immigrant, gradually starting teaching Monroe the art of baking and eventually promoted Monroe as the first and only black baker in his bakery.  It was there Monroe learned to bake rolls, cakes, pies, and pastries.  Monroe recalled, "Mr. Hoeffken always sampled everything before it left the store."  Cake with too much salt was discarded.  Monroe acquired Mr. Hoeffken's distinction for quality. 

When Monroe Jackson starting working at Hoeffken's Bakery at the age of fifteen, he never imagined that his dishwashing job was a stepping stone.  Like his father, Monroe Jackson Jr., started from the ground up in the bakery businesss.   Today, the two of them rise long before dawn Monday through Saturday and bake delicious pastries.
